What you'll do:


As part of our growing sales team, you will need to take the lead in our sales teams to successfully continue to grow our business in Europe.


As a strategic advisor to the customer, you will work and sell across multiple executive stakeholders including business and IT functions.

You will drive discovery, strategy and value mapping as you analyze the customer's business need so that you can position the best solutions and concepts to achieve the desired outcome.


You will have your home in the EMEA Sales team and you will lead the sales strategy through collaboration with your extended team in Sales Engineering, Professional Services, Customer Success, and Marketing to execute strategic account plans to drive large software deals and bring them to closure in DACH & BENELUX territory.


You will report to our SVP of Sales EMEA and your workplace will be in our Karlsruhe office or home office.

We live our "hybrid way of working", from home and from the office.

You may be required to travel to company events, customer meetings and other exceptional occurrences.


Who will thrive in this role:

You are an experienced and dynamic sales executive who knows how to strategically plan and drive sales negotiations with a strong focus on new business, new logo acquisition.

You have a growth mindset and are interested in cross functional collaboration. Supporting each other is important for your team. You value transparency and honesty. Being at ease with influential communication up to executive level, international teams and multiple cultures is in your nature.


Key skills required:


  • At least 7 years of experience selling enterprise software solutions to global large enterprise accounts
  • Bachelor education or more, an engineering background is a plus
  • Proven track records of sales achievements
  • Experience with global customers and partners in the industrial segment is key
  • Familiarity with adjacent software categories is a plus, like Price Optimization, Contract Lifecycle Management, Visualization and CAD
  • Excellent presentation and communication skills in English AND in German with the ability to lead customer discussions and crossfunctional projects

The recruitment process consists of:


  • Cultural and background interview with global talent acquisition
  • Personality test and logical ability test
  • Business interview with our hiring manager
  • Interview with our CRO and role play
  • Offer
  • Reference check
